JOB PURPOSE
The incumbent is responsible to effectively and efficiently supervise, coordinate, troubleshoot, expedite and monitor the implementation/execution of all civil and structural related activities (e.g. site preparation, site construction, scaffolding, road works, drainage, sewage, plumbing and plant structure/building including jetty and Non-Process Buildings and facilities), general housekeeping and all other external services according to project specifications, statutory requirements and engineering best practices in order to achieve project targets for schedule, HSE, quality and budget.

JOB ACCOUNTABILITY
1 Supervise, coordinate, troubleshoot, expedite and monitor contractors executing all the civil and structural related activities and other support activities to support overall TTM EVA Project in accordance with company's policies, procedures, work instruction, statutory requirements, and engineering best practices in order to achieve project targets.
2 Safe execution of all the civil and structural related activities and all external services by ensuring project works are carried out in accordance to PTS approved instructions, company procedures and work methods. In addition to assist in developing safety programs and enforcing safety regulation, safety procedures, conducting safety audit in order to achieve zero lost time accident I incident (LTI) in all wok activities.
3 Participate in Job Safety Analysis (JSA), Job Method Sheet (JMS) development, discussion with contractors and supervise, monitor and enforcement in the implementation of JSA and JMS.
4 Consult PTS and other relevant approved engineering practices for civil related modification works for project works.
5 Develop and implement quality awareness program among contractor's personnel, conduct on site quality audit and inspection and enforce quality procedures in order to ensure contractors delivers as per company requirement
6 Records and documentation of civil related and external services activities are properly documented into the project documentation system.
7 Implement and monitor the utilization of Standard Operating Procedures, work instructions and inspection checklist by contractor to ensure compliance to ISO requirement and best engineering practices.
8 Monitor and evaluate contractors' performance to ensure compliance to the contract requirements. Also maintain good working relationship with services providers/contractors and specialist for timely and successful completion of assigned tasks.
9 Facilitate and contribute towards department and company quality improvement projects by contributing comments, information, ideas, solutions and plan development and implementation for continuous improvement in related field within the area of responsibility to achieve project and company objectives.
MAJOR CHALLENGES
1 Fully conversant of oil, gas and petrochemical plant civil structure and experience in major facility construction works.
2 Experience in designing facility (road, substation, drainage system, foundation) required for TTM EVA Project.
3 Knowledge in civil and structural design code, engineering standards, quality system and safety standards.
4 Experience in supervising contractor to carry out value engineering and fit for purpose design to ensure technical and budget requirements are met within the context of TTM EVA Project.
